A small, members only bar located at 4100 Juniata St, south of Tower Grove Park.

The PDT is a dark purple, two story, shotgun style building on the corner of Juniata St and Oak Hill Ave that was clearly a house recently. The letters ‘PDT’ have been painted above the corner door in black and gold calligraphy. The windows are tinted black so it’s difficult to see inside, but it’s written in fluorescent marker when they’re open. Otherwise there are no posted business hours. On the door are two locks, one for member’s keys and one for the owners.

As you walk in, to the right in the corner is a leather couch and two leather wingback chairs. Just past that is the bar running the length of the wall with about ten stools. On the left side are a couple tables, each with two chairs. All the furniture is unique, no two pieces the same, and everything including the bar appears to be handmade and custom. The lighting throughout is dim purple, blue, and red hues and the walls are covered in various types of art.

There are three large white porcelain statues of women and red flowers around the place that appear to have fire damage. Some may recognize them from DeeDee’s Place.

Behind the bar, surrounded by a large liquor selection, is an old timey record player that has been seemingly gutted and rebuilt into some kind of speaker system. It tends to play nu jazz, trip hop, and downtempo music.

On the wall behind the bar is a black 'whiteboard' that lists the specials of the night as well as a wooden sign that reads, "Tell management if anyone offers you magic, or does magic in front of you. Strictly no magic allowed."

At the very back of the bar on the far wall is a door to what appears to be a bathroom as well as set of stairs leading up.
